excel怎么画出一条二条斜线

excel怎么画出一条二条斜线

在Excel中绘制一条或两条斜线的步骤包括:插入形状工具、使用单元格格式设置、使用图表工具。其中,通过插入形状工具的方法最为简便和灵活。下面将详细介绍这一方法。

一、使用插入形状工具绘制斜线

1. 插入一条斜线

要在Excel中插入一条斜线,可以使用插入形状工具,这是一个非常灵活的方法。具体步骤如下:

  1. 打开Excel文件,选择你需要插入斜线的工作表。
  2. 点击“插入”选项卡,找到“形状”按钮。
  3. 在弹出的形状列表中选择“直线”形状。
  4. 绘制斜线:点击并拖动鼠标,从单元格的一个角到另一个角绘制斜线。这样你可以得到一条从左上角到右下角的斜线。

2. 调整斜线的格式

绘制完斜线后,你可以调整斜线的格式以满足你的需求:

  1. 选择斜线,然后右键点击选择“设置形状格式”。
  2. 在右侧的设置面板中,你可以调整斜线的颜色、粗细、透明度等属性。
  3. 你还可以通过拖动斜线的两个端点来调整斜线的位置和角度

3. 添加文字

如果你需要在斜线上添加文字,可以通过插入文本框来实现:

  1. 点击“插入”选项卡,找到“文本框”按钮。
  2. 选择“水平文本框”,然后在你需要的位置绘制文本框
  3. 输入你需要的文字,然后调整文本框的大小和位置,使其与斜线对齐。

二、使用单元格格式设置

1. 插入一条斜线

在Excel单元格中插入斜线,还可以通过设置单元格格式来实现。具体步骤如下:

  1. 选择单元格:选择你需要插入斜线的单元格。
  2. 右键单击,选择“设置单元格格式”。
  3. 选择“边框”选项卡,在“边框”选项卡中找到斜线样式。
  4. 选择左上到右下的斜线样式,然后点击“确定”。

2. 添加文字

在单元格中添加文字,可以通过使用斜线分隔法:

  1. 选择单元格,然后输入你需要的文字内容。
  2. 输入完成后,按下Alt + Enter键,这样可以在单元格中换行。
  3. 在单元格中用空格键调整文字的位置,使其在斜线的两侧显示。

三、使用图表工具绘制斜线

1. 插入图表

使用图表工具绘制斜线是另一种方法,适用于更复杂的需求:

  1. 选择数据区域,然后点击“插入”选项卡,找到“图表”按钮。
  2. 选择一种适合的图表类型,例如散点图
  3. 插入图表后,点击图表区域,选择“添加图表元素”。
  4. 选择“趋势线”选项,然后选择“线性趋势线”。

2. 调整斜线的格式

插入趋势线后,你可以调整趋势线的格式:

  1. 选择趋势线,然后右键点击选择“设置趋势线格式”。
  2. 在右侧的设置面板中,你可以调整趋势线的颜色、样式、粗细等属性。

3. 添加文字

在图表中添加文字,可以通过图表工具的文本框功能:

  1. 选择图表区域,然后点击“插入”选项卡,找到“文本框”按钮。
  2. 选择“水平文本框”,然后在你需要的位置绘制文本框
  3. 输入你需要的文字,然后调整文本框的大小和位置,使其与斜线对齐。

四、使用VBA代码绘制斜线

1. 插入一条斜线

对于高级用户,还可以通过使用VBA代码来绘制斜线:

  1. 按下Alt + F11打开VBA编辑器。
  2. 在VBA编辑器中,选择“插入”>“模块”,插入一个新模块。
  3. 输入以下代码:
    Sub AddDiagonalLine()

    Dim ws As Worksheet

    Set ws = ThisWorkbook.Sheets("Sheet1")

    ws.Shapes.AddLine _

    BeginX:=ws.Range("A1").Left, _

    BeginY:=ws.Range("A1").Top, _

    EndX:=ws.Range("A1").Left + ws.Range("A1").Width, _

    EndY:=ws.Range("A1").Top + ws.Range("A1").Height

    End Sub

  4. 关闭VBA编辑器,返回Excel,然后按下Alt + F8,运行“AddDiagonalLine”宏。

2. 调整斜线的格式

使用VBA代码添加的斜线,你可以通过代码调整其格式:

  1. 在VBA代码中,添加以下代码以调整斜线的颜色和粗细:
    Sub AddDiagonalLine()

    Dim ws As Worksheet

    Dim line As Shape

    Set ws = ThisWorkbook.Sheets("Sheet1")

    Set line = ws.Shapes.AddLine _

    BeginX:=ws.Range("A1").Left, _

    BeginY:=ws.Range("A1").Top, _

    EndX:=ws.Range("A1").Left + ws.Range("A1").Width, _

    EndY:=ws.Range("A1").Top + ws.Range("A1").Height

    line.Line.ForeColor.RGB = RGB(255, 0, 0)

    line.Line.Weight = 2

    End Sub

3. 添加文字

通过VBA代码添加文字,可以通过形状对象的TextFrame属性:

  1. 在VBA代码中,添加以下代码以在斜线上添加文字:
    Sub AddDiagonalLine()

    Dim ws As Worksheet

    Dim line As Shape

    Dim textBox As Shape

    Set ws = ThisWorkbook.Sheets("Sheet1")

    Set line = ws.Shapes.AddLine _

    BeginX:=ws.Range("A1").Left, _

    BeginY:=ws.Range("A1").Top, _

    EndX:=ws.Range("A1").Left + ws.Range("A1").Width, _

    EndY:=ws.Range("A1").Top + ws.Range("A1").Height

    line.Line.ForeColor.RGB = RGB(255, 0, 0)

    line.Line.Weight = 2

    Set textBox = ws.Shapes.AddTextbox(msoTextOrientationHorizontal, _

    ws.Range("A1").Left, ws.Range("A1").Top, ws.Range("A1").Width, 20)

    textBox.TextFrame.Characters.Text = "斜线文字"

    End Sub

通过以上几种方法,你可以在Excel中灵活地绘制一条或两条斜线。无论是通过插入形状工具、使用单元格格式设置、使用图表工具还是通过VBA代码,你都可以根据具体需求选择最合适的方法。

相关问答FAQs:

1. 如何在Excel中画出一条斜线?
在Excel中,您可以通过使用斜线工具来画出一条斜线。选择您想要画斜线的单元格或区域,然后在"开始"选项卡的"字体"组中,点击"斜线"按钮。选择适当的斜线样式,单击确定即可。

2. 如何在Excel中画出两条斜线?
要在Excel中画出两条斜线,您可以使用单元格格式设置功能。首先,选择您要添加两条斜线的单元格或区域,然后点击右键选择"格式单元格"。在弹出的对话框中,切换到"边框"选项卡,并选择"斜线"按钮。选择合适的斜线样式和颜色,然后单击确定即可。

3. 如何在Excel中画出多个斜线?
要在Excel中画出多个斜线,您可以使用绘图工具。首先,点击"插入"选项卡中的"形状"按钮,在弹出的菜单中选择"线条"。然后,用鼠标在单元格或工作表上拖动以绘制斜线。您可以使用线条的属性栏来调整线条的样式、颜色和粗细。绘制完成后,您可以将线条调整到合适的位置和角度,并复制粘贴以创建更多的斜线。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4810077

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部